Book Courtyard by Marriott Houston Sugar Land/Stafford, Houston (TX)
📍 12655 Southwest Freeway, Houston (TX)



Whether you are in Houston (TX) for business or leisure, Courtyard by Marriott Houston Sugar Land/Stafford showcases a seamless experience. It serves as an excellent starting point to uncover the hidden gems of the region.
With a commendable rating of 7.8/10, Courtyard by Marriott Houston Sugar Land/Stafford is dedicated to maintaining high standards. The interiors are designed to make you feel cosy the moment you step inside. As a bonus, the staff is trained to assist with any request to ensure a smooth stay.
At Courtyard by Marriott Houston Sugar Land/Stafford, the facilities are curated to secures a hassle-free visit. The rooms are equipped with all the essentials needed for a restful night's sleep. Connectivity is seamless, allowing you to stay in touch with work or family with ease.
Conveniently placed at 12655 Southwest Freeway, Courtyard by Marriott Houston Sugar Land/Stafford acts as a strategic launchpad. From here, accessing the city's main attractions is straightforward. You will find yourself in good company, with properties such as Motel 6 Humble, TX - Houston International Airport nearby.
In summary, Courtyard by Marriott Houston Sugar Land/Stafford is a pleasant choice for your Houston (TX) itinerary. Don't miss out on your preferred dates.
Landmarks
Access